Rachel, using my phone please excuse the typos. I'm watching your antique journal playlist, and you just mentioned about the grime on the paper. I just saw a demonstration of how to clean old documents, especially if you wanted to restore the original cover. You get a white artist eraser. It has to be white, but not the gummy ones. You have to use a garlic grater. The lemon ones aren't fine enough. And you need several little piles. You put those in a small clump across the document about 1 to 2 inches apart, and then very gently begin to roll the shreds in a circular pattern and you will soon begin to see the orig finish. It's like magic. I'd practice on something that's not 400 yrs old .. jk ... but it really works. You could try on not really vintage images to remove the paper to put it in the freezer. Seriously, it freezes the glue and helps it peel off. I worked on a lawsuit where priceless photos were mishandled and that's what the restorer did at the Smithsonian lab in DC.
